| From | Greg Kroah-Hartman <> | Subject | [PATCH 5.4 12/72] xfs: Fix assert failure in xfs_setattr_size() | Date | Fri, 5 Mar 2021 13:21:14 +0100 |
| |
From: Yumei Huang <yuhuang@redhat.com>
commit 88a9e03beef22cc5fabea344f54b9a0dfe63de08 upstream.
An assert failure is triggered by syzkaller test due to ATTR_KILL_PRIV is not cleared before xfs_setattr_size. As ATTR_KILL_PRIV is not checked/used by xfs_setattr_size, just remove it from the assert.
